4.4 SYSTEM HIGH CLOCK
The system high clock is from internal 6MHz oscillator.
4.4.1 INTERNAL HIGH RC
The chip is built-in RC type internal high clock (6MHz). The system clock is from internal 6MHz RC type oscillator.
IHRC:
High clock is internal 6MHz oscillator RC type.
4.5 SYSTEM LOW CLOCK
The system low clock source is the internal low-speed oscillator built in the micro-controller. The low-speed oscillator
uses RC type oscillator circuit. The frequency is affected by the voltage and temperature of the system. In common
condition, the frequency of the RC oscillator is about 24KHz.
The internal low RC supports watchdog clock source and system slow mode controlled by CLKMD.
)
Flosc = Internal low RC oscillator (24KHz).
)
Slow mode Fcpu = Flosc / 4
There are two conditions to stop internal low RC. One is power down mode, and the other is green mode of 24KHz
mode and watchdog disable. If system is in 24KHz mode and watchdog disable, only 24KHz oscillator actives and
system is under low power consumption.

Note: The internal low-speed clock can’t be turned off individually. It is controlled by CPUM0, CPUM1 (24
KHz, watchdog disable) bits of OSCM register.
